The Coastal City of Caliphus
Shortly after finding the Key of Alda and the Foxwood Scroll, the party decides that they should visit Frith’s mother in Takka in hopes that she might be able to translate what is written in the scroll. The party stops in Caliphus on their way to Takka after leaving the Isle of Baasan. While in Caliphus the party can shop around and buy new outfits from the tailors to match the style of the island. Nothing major will happen while in Caliphus. From here the party will travel north to cross the Yuzuth Uplands.
Industry & Trade
Today the markets of Caliphus have grown to be staggering large and Caliphus plays an important role in Soliman cuisine. The markets in the city sell every kind of fish that can be caught and eaten, as well as a massive variety of seafood and land foods. They also have a unique jewelry market, ranging from crystalized scales to pearls.
History
Caliphus is a large port market on the southern coast of Ixios. It was originally a town meant for fishermen to come and train to fish on the water. It grew a large market around the buying and selling of all kinds of fish and different kinds of sea food.
Architecture
The style of architecture is what one would have seen in ancient Atlantis, a mix between South American Aztec and ancient Greece. Large pillars and columns supporting triangular shaped roofs, as well as an incorporated style of step pyramids. They style is set apart as it all very oceanic in its look and theme. It’s common to see coral used as décor and there are large statues of mythological oceanic beings.
